The present invention relates generally to the field of accessories for mobile devices, and more particularly to a multi-functional magnetic multi-tool accessory for use with a mobile device such as a mobile phone or tablet computer.
Often, users of mobile devices such as a mobile phone or tablet computer may wish to achieve a better grip on the device through the use of an external accessory. Mobile device users may also wish to support a mobile on a surface at a particular viewing angle when looking at the mobile device for long periods of time, such as when watching a movie or on a videoconference. In many cases, previously known devices for supporting a phone may only accomplish one of these tasks or may be limited in use to certain orientations of the device. Additionally, some previous accessories may be difficult to remove and reattach to the mobile device, and/or may have a weaker attachment with the device than would be desired, any of which may prevent the accessory from being used for additional functions or from being placed in alternative orientations.
It is also the case that people sometimes prefer accessories to serve multiple functions. For example, people commonly need bottle openers to open beverages, but may not always have a bottle opener readily available. Some previously known bottle openers are configured to be carried on a keyring. However, with the widespread adoption of keyless actuators and locking devices, more and more people are forgoing keys and are instead relying on mobile devices to operate locks and other equipment. As a result, many people no longer carry keys, and therefore no longer carry the bottle opening devices that may previously have been carried on the associated keyrings.
Accordingly, it has been found that needs exist for a multi-tool accessory for a mobile device capable of providing a grip, a stand, and a bottle opener functionality, and that can easily and securely be attached to and detached from a mobile device. It is to the provision of a multi-functional magnetic multi-tool for use with a mobile-device meeting these and other needs that the present invention is primarily directed.
In example embodiments, the present invention provides multi-functional magnetic multi-tool accessory for use with a mobile device such as a mobile phone, tablet computer, or other mobile electronic device. In example embodiments, the multi-tool or multi-functional accessory comprises a first generally annular body or attachment portion configured for attachment to the mobile device, and a second generally annular body or support portion pivotally attached to the attachment portion and configured for supporting the electronic device when placed on a support surface or hand-held by a user. In some example embodiments, the attachment portion has an inner dimension that is generally larger than an outer dimension of the support portion, allowing the bodies to pivot between a closed configuration wherein the bodies are generally concentric and nested with one another and one or more open configurations wherein the bodies are generally non-concentric and extended relative to one another. The attachment portion may further comprise one or more magnets and a surface having an opening. The magnet(s) within the multi-tool accessory allow it to be magnetically and removably attached to other objects, such as mobile devices and/or cases capable of receiving magnetic attachments.
The multi-tool or multi-functional accessory is configured to perform various functions. For example, a user may use the multi-tool as a grip when attached to an object, such as a mobile phone, tablet or other mobile device. To do so, the multi-tool is placed in an open configuration wherein the support portion is extended at an angle relative to the attachment portion which is attached to the mobile device. A user may then grasp the support portion and/or place a finger through an opening therein to gain a better grip or hold upon the attached mobile device.
The multi-tool or multi-functional accessory may also be used as a stand for a mobile device. To do so, the user attaches the attachment portion of the multi-tool accessory to a mobile device and/or case. With the multi-tool accessory in an open configuration with the support portion extended from the attachment portion, the mobile device and/or case are set on their edge on a support surface and angled such that the support portion contacts the surface and supports the mobile device in a desired position for use. The angle of the support portion relative to the mobile device and/or case can be adjusted so as to adjust the viewing or support angle of the mobile device and/or case relative to the surface.
The multi-tool or multi-functional accessory may also be used as a bottle opener. To open a bottle with the multi-tool, a portion of the accessory, for example a tab or flange extending inwardly from a central opening or channel within the attachment portion of the accessory, is placed such that it is partially between the lip at the opening of a bottle and its bottle cap. When sufficient twisting or prying force is applied to the multi-tool accessory by a user, the bottle cap becomes dislodged from the bottle to expose the bottle opening.

In the example embodiment shown, the multi-tool or multi-functional accessory 100 is configured for magnetic attraction and attachment to one or more magnetic components within the mobile device 300 and/or a case 200 for a mobile device, such as for example the Apple MagSafe magnetic attachment system. The magnetic attraction between the multi-tool or multi-functional accessory 100 and the mobile device 300 causes the multi-tool or multi-functional accessory 100 to become securely but removably affixed, and therefore removably attached, to the surface of the case 200 or phone 300. In some embodiments, the case 200 is removed from the phone 300, and the multi-tool or multi-functional accessory 100 is removably attached directly to the phone 300. In other embodiments, the case 200 additionally or alternatively comprises one or more magnetic components that magnetically attract the multi-tool or multi-functional accessory 100 such that the multi-tool or multi-functional accessory 100 becomes removably attached to the case 200. In alternate embodiments, the multi-functional accessory may be attached to a mobile device or case for a mobile device by other or additional attachment means such as hook-and-loop fasteners, releasable adhesive, detachable clips or other couplings, interengaging friction-fit elements, other magnetic arrangements, or the like.
In the example embodiments depicted, the support portion 120 further comprises a connection arm 140 extending toward the attachment portion 110 and pivotally connected to the pivot or hinge pin, thus allowing the attachment portion and the support portion to pivot relative to one another. In other embodiments, the support portion may comprise a pivot or hinge pin, and the attachment portion may comprise a pivot arm. In yet further embodiments both the attachment portion and the support portion may comprise a pivot or hinge pin, and the connection arm may extend between the two pivots. The pivot or hinge coupling between the attachment portion 110 and the support portion 120 may be freely or loosely rotating, or in alternate embodiments may provide frictional or indexed rotation for selective positioning and positional retention of the accessory in one or more desired configurations.

In example embodiments, the magnetic attraction between the multi-tool accessory and one or both of the case and mobile device is such that the multi-tool accessory remains attached to the mobile device and/or the case when the phone and/or case is otherwise unsupported, with a magnetic attachment force sufficient to support the weight of the mobile device with which the accessory is intended for use, and to resist unintentional detachment in the normal intended use and movement of the device. However, the magnetic attraction is weak enough that the multi-tool accessory may still be separated and detached from the phone and/or case by a user through the application of moderate manual force without damage to the accessory or to the mobile device or case.
